Project Controls Analyst - 2+ years experience
AECOM is a global infrastructure consulting firm committed to delivering a better world. They are seeking a Project Controls Analyst who will support high-profile projects by providing cost analysis, cost reconciliation, and assisting in project reporting processes.

Responsibilities
Works with the company financial and cornerstone systems and processes
Applies financial terminology, measures, financial data analysis concepts and principles in assignments
Recognizes processes/project actions that may lead to project financial impact
Develops and maintains WBS for small projects
Assists in the use of drawings and specifications in the establishment of project baseline data
Begins basic analysis of cost and schedule variances
Develops knowledge of accounting principles
Assists in assembling data for trending and forecasting
Understands progress/performance data and associated concepts and principles. Participates in the collection of progress data and review of performance trends
Familiar with earned value, scope control and change management concepts, principles and methodologies
Collects data and produces an initial analysis on manpower, labor hour, and labor cost requirements versus budget limitations
Collects and analyzes data for tracking actual cost to funding limitations
Provides support to tracking purchase order and subcontract commitments and expenditures
Familiar with the concepts and principles of project revenue and cost
Exposure to basic scheduling and cost baseline fundamentals, concepts and principles
Introduced to performance management and cost/schedule integration concepts and principles
Develops knowledge of scope control and change management
Supports project reporting process as required
May participate in project cost review meetings
